The Maccabees, The Big Pink, Bombay Bicycle Club and The Drums have been confirmed for next year's NME Awards Tour. All four bands will play 14 shows around the UK in February 2010. 'Toothpaste Kisses' art-rockers The Maccabees will headline the dates. Previous NME Awards Tours have hosted acts including The Ting Tings, Klaxons, Arctic Monkeys, The Killers and The Cribs. Iggy Pop has revealed plans to record a number of lost Stooges songs. The 62-year-old recently reconciled with Iggy and The Stooges guitarist James Williamson and the pair are said to be eager to work on tracks they wrote together in the early '70s. Saw studio Twisted Pictures has acquired the cinematic rights to Image Comics' Sorrow. Originally released as a four-issue miniseries in 2007, the horror comic was the result of a collaboration between Rick Remender, Seth Peck and Francesco Francavilla. According to Shock Til You Drop, screenwriter Michael Hidalgo is on board to adapt the script and Saw duo Mark Burg and Oren Koules will act as producers. Sorrow is a modern ghost story focusing on a young girl and her friends as they find themselves trapped in a haunted town, where the spirits of the dead seek to claim the bodies of the living. Titan Publishing has released its first batch of digital Wallace & Gromit comics for iPhone and iPod Touch devices. Four downloadable books are currently available via the App Store, 'The W-Files', 'Parts & Labour', 'Big In Japan' and 'Where There's Muck There's Brass'.
